Thank you for suggesting that diamond, I was looking at that one as well but I wasn’t sure how visible that inclusion on the top would be. Is there any “ideal” time or season to buy a diamond (e.g. special discounts)? Thanks.
It is eye-clean. There is no real time to buy. I guess you can wait for cyber-monday, but the discounts are very minimal. Once they offered a free 2mm comfort fit setting. That’s only $180 and you may not even want that setting. If you find the right diamond you are best off jumping on it (you’d be taking a risk waiting till Monday that the diamond will sell out from under you) since the possible gain is so minimal.
